IMHO, I wouldnt feed any of my snakes W/C snakes. They can harbor all kinds of nasty parasites and viruses/bacteria. This can in turn be passed on to your snakes. In addition, if your snakes are eating F/T mice no problems, and you feed them snakes, they may get a taste for snakes and refuse mice. Just my .$02.
